51 Victoria Embankment is a 134 m² / 1,442 sq ft terraced home in Darlington. It sold for £135,000 in July 2019. Indexed forward to today's value, that sale is roughly £180k. Recent local prices imply a broad valuation context of £133k to £224k based on its internal area. The Land Registry and EPC data was last updated 1 June 2026.

- Valuation
- The most recent sale price indexed forward to today's value is £180,482. This is one data point to inform the valuation. Another method is the valuation implied by what comparable homes are selling for. Homes in Darlington are now selling for between £990 and £1,670 per square metre (£91 and £155 per square foot). Based on an internal area of 134 m², this implies a valuation between £133,000 and £224,000. Treat this as context only.
